Kids want guidance when it comes to navigating sexuality and gender. But those conversations often bring up feelings of embarrassment and avoidance for all parties involved. As adults, it’s our job to create an open and honest space where kids and teens feel comfortable learning more about their bodies.

Join Bodies podcast host Allison Behringer and educators Shafia Zaloom and Nadine Thornhill to hear how they approach sex education. Their work goes beyond the basics of human anatomy and pregnancy. It’s about cultivating healthy relationships, understanding consent, gender socialization, power dynamics and pleasure. We’ll also be joined by San Francisco teen Elizabeth Edwards, who will share her experience taking Shafia’s course in love and romantic relationships.
